Glass Doors at Channel 12 News Office Smashed Twice in Three Weeks in Tel Aviv
The glass entrance doors to Channel 12 News offices in Tel Aviv were smashed again on Tuesday, marking the second such incident within less than a month. The latest attack occurred about three weeks after a similar event on July 5, when the same doors were damaged by stones. Channel 12 reported that no further details were provided regarding the circumstances or the identity of the perpetrator in the recent case.
Despite the similarity between the two incidents and their occurrence at the same location, no suspects have been apprehended for either attack. Channel 12 described the recent event as identical to the one earlier in July. Authorities have not confirmed whether the two cases are connected beyond the method and location of the damage.
This second attack adds to concerns about security at the news outlet, as the first incident remains unresolved and no arrests have been made. No additional information has been released about potential motives or ongoing investigations.
